33. What can be a hazard when driving in autumn?
Explanation
Once leaves become wet, they can create slippery and dangerous driving conditions. The end of daylight saving time means reduced visibility on the roads, which can create unsafe driving conditions. Slow down on slick roads and increase your following distance when rain or mist begins to fall. Just a small amount of water can mix with oil and grease on the roadway to create slippery conditions.
34. When dealing with pedestrians, a driver must:
Explanation
You must do everything you can to prevent striking a pedestrian or another vehicle, regardless of the circumstances. It is the driver’s basic responsibility to be alert to pedestrians and to yield the right-of-way to all pedestrians, even if the pedestrian is crossing the street where they should not be.

36. An octagonal sign is always a:
Explanation
Octagonal signs are always stop signs. Come to a complete stop when approaching a red, eight-sided sign.

38. A seat belt should be adjusted so that it:
Explanation
Lap belts should fit snugly across your hip bones and the lower part of your abdomen. Shoulder belts should sit comfortably so that you can insert your fist between the belt and your chest.
39. When you want to change lanes, you should:
Explanation
When changing lanes, maintain a safe following distance between your vehicle and the vehicle in front of you. Check in your mirrors and blind spots to make sure there are no vehicles driving in your path or already entering the lane you want to enter.
